Description

A delicious taste of the secret, exciting and often dangerous history of illicit spirits; Britain has always been a nation of enthusiastic drinkers. Any attempt to regulate, limit or ban our favourite tipple has been met with imaginative and daring acts of defiance: selling gin through pipes in a London back alley; smuggling brandy across Cornish clifftops; or dodging bombs and shrapnel running whisky in the Blitz.; The history of spirits in Britain has more illicit in it than licit - and that history has shaped these isles. Packed with wild stories, as well as authentic recipes from the past, Rebellious Spirits reveals the colourful characters and tall tales behind Britain's long and lively love affair with booze.

Author Biography:

Ruth Ball works at East London Liquor Company, a London distillery. She is a chemist and former bartender, and was the founder of Alchemist Dreams, a company dedicated to making handmade liqueurs blended to order for high-profile creative events with The British Library, Starwood Hotels and The Science Museum Group. She is also the author of Rough Spirits and High Society: The Culture of Drink.
